Are You Aware Of These Common Problems Which Are Stealing Your Sleep? By: Neelima Reddy | Dec 7th 2009 - Understand how menstruation, pregnancy and menopause affect a woman"€™s sleep and how to minimize these conditions for improving sleep. Women face difficulty in falling and staying asleep than men. Many issues can affect women"€™s sleep. Hormone level changes, illness, stress, lifestyle and sleep environment are some of the issues. Some unique conditions such as menstrual cycle, pregnancy and menopause can interfere with quality of sleep in women.
